Wildert, België (Antwerpen) - Sint-Jan Baptistkerk
Municipal: Essen
Region:Vlaanderen
Address: Sint-Jansstraat 85, 2910, Essen

Description nr.: 2048998.

Built by: firma Jos Stevens (1928)
Destroyed (1944)


  • In 1928 a new organ was dedicated in the church of Saint John Baptist in Wildert. The church building was dedicated in 1886, but at that time a second hand organ was installed. The new organ was built by the company Jos. Stevens. It was a gift of the parish to the pastor, because of the 50-year jubilee of the parish foundation. On November 11, 1928 the organ was dedicated, with a concert by Flor Peeters.
  • The church and the organ were destroyed through war activities in 1944.

Technical data
Number of stops per division
- Groot Orgel4
- Reciet Expressief6
- Pedaal2
Total number of stops12
Key actionPneumatic
Stop actionPneumatic
Windchest(s)Cone chests

Specification
Groot Orgel: Bourdon 16', Monter 8', Bourdon Harmonique 8', Prestant 4'.
Reciet Expressief: Flûte Harmonique 8', Viola di Gamba 8', Voix Céleste 8', Mélophoon 4', Doublet 2', Trompet Harmonique 8'.
Pedaal: Sous-bas 16', Bas 8'.
Couplers: Groot Orgel - Reciet, Bovenoktaaf Groot Orgel - Reciet, Onderoktaaf Groot Orgel - Reciet, Pedaal - Groot Orgel, Pedaal - Reciet.
Accessories: Tutti.
